Charitable giving is a commendable act demonstrating social responsibility. When you contribute to eligible organizations under Section 80G of the Indian Income Tax Act, you not only help society but also avail certain tax advantages. Section 80G provides a tax deduction for donations given to registered charitable trusts and institutions. This suggests that your taxable income is lowered by the amount offered, effectively offering financial relief.

  • Understanding the eligibility criteria for Section 80G donations is crucial.
  • Confirm that the charitable organization receive your donations under Section 80G.
  • Preserve proper documentation of your donations, including receipts and acknowledgement letters.

Recording Charitable Donations in Your Accounting Journal

When contributing to charitable causes, it's important to keep accurate records for both tax purposes and to ensure the transparency of your financial contributions. Registering these donations in your accounting journal is a essential step in this method.

A typical gift entry would comprise the following:

* The date of the donation

* The name of the charity or organization

* A short description of the donation

* The value donated

Confirm that you use a consistent and systematic method for recording your charitable donations. This will simplify the procedure of generating tax reports at year-end.

Crucial Guide to Donation Receipts and Tax Deductions

Donating to charitable organizations is a compassionate act that can have a positive effect on the world. However, it's important to understand the tax implications of your donations. A proper donation receipt is essential for claiming tax deductions on your charitable contributions.

When donating, always ask for a donation receipt from the organization. The receipt should precisely indicate the date of the donation, the amount donated, and a description of the goods or services received (if any). Moreover, make sure the receipt contains the organization's name, address, and tax-exempt status.

Keep your donation receipts in a safe place for at least three years. This will allow you to quickly retrieve them when filing your taxes. Keep in mind that the IRS has specific guidelines regarding charitable deductions, so it's always a good idea to consult a tax professional for clarification.

Navigating Charitable Donations with U/S 80G Provisions

Charitable donations are a noble act that social responsibility and contribute to the betterment of society. In India, the Income Tax Act extends significant benefits to donors who contribute to eligible organizations registered under Section 80G of the Act. This section provides for tax exemptions on donations made to approved charitable trusts and societies. Comprehending the intricacies of U/S 80G provisions is crucial for donors to avail the full benefits of their contributions.

  • Firstly, it is essential to select eligible organizations registered under Section 80G. This data can be accessed from the Income Tax Department's website or by consulting a tax professional.
